Method for processing peripheral surface of rotor shaft for supercharger for motor car, involves providing rotor shaft, sharpening hardnesses of peripheral surface of rotor shaft, and precision-grinding peripheral surface of rotor shaft

摘要

The method involves providing a rotor shaft (2) made of steel, and sharpening hardnesses of a peripheral surface (11) of the rotor shaft by utilizing a grinding disk (4). The peripheral surface of the rotor shaft is precision-grinded by utilizing a supplementary grinding disk (12). The grinding disk and/or the supplementary grinding disk are made of corundum or cubic boron nitride or diamond. The rotor shaft is arranged in a receiving device (6) in a captured condition with respect to the supplementary grinding disk, which is supported at a base unit (3) by a drive unit (8). Independent claims are also included for the following: (1) a rotor shaft for a supercharger (2) a device for machining a rotor shaft.
